Readline Fix

A fix for hanging when importing readline module on macOS by checking if readline module is being imported on macOS and skips the import if it is to avoid hanging.

Comment on lines +482 to +484
if sys.platform == "darwin" and modinfo.name == "readline":
logger.error("Skipping readline module for macOS")
return
Copy link
Copy Markdown

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

P1 Badge Keep strict builds from silently passing skipped readline

Returning early for readline on macOS makes check_module_import() report success without ever executing bootstrap_load(spec). In ModuleChecker.check(), any non-exception path is treated as a successful import and added to shared_ok, so --strict/PYTHONSTRICTEXTENSIONBUILD can no longer detect a broken readline module on macOS. This undermines the strict-build guarantee and can let a bad extension ship undetected.
